luckless
If you describe someone or something as luckless, you mean that they are unsuccessful or unfortunate.

luckless in American English
having no good luck; unlucky
adjective: having no luck; unfortunate; hapless; ill-fated; turning out or ending disastrously

luckless in British English
adjective: having no luck; unlucky
